In particular, print(Mpow) runs much, much faster than print(M). Output: 650 terms total in looped dot result The result is a symbolic matrix variable of type symmatrix. I believe the same applies to mupad, although it supports a superset of the symbolic commands supported by Matlab. In other words, the definition of A has to be explicit. fInv inv (f) fInv (A, a0, a1, a2) a 0 I 2 a 1 A a 2 A 2 - 1 Evaluate the inverse for the matrix value A 2 - 1 - 1 2 and the coefficient values a 0 - 1, a 1 2, and a 2 3. In Matlab, a matrix is a symbolic matrix because the entries are symbolic scalars. Print("%d terms total in matrix_power result\n" % countterms(Mpow)) The result is a symbolic matrix function of type symfunmatrix. Print("%d terms total in looped dot result\n" % countterms(M)) Matrix Row Echelon Calculator - Symbolab Matrix Row Echelon Calculator Reduce matrix to row echelon form step-by-step Matrices Vectors full pad Examples The Matrix Symbolab Version Matrix, the one with numbers, arranged with rows and columns, is extremely useful in most scientific fields. Here's how you can count the terms in the result array: import numpy as np The expressions in the resulting array will be more simplified with fewer terms. Added bonus: matrix_power works better with arrays of Sympy expressionsįor whatever reason, matrix_power seems to work better with Sympy than the iterative dot method. Matrix operations calculator Calculator will show work for each operation. The calculator will generate a step by step explanation for each of these operations. multiplication, addition and subtraction. W = sy.Symbol("w") v = sy.Symbol("v") p = sy.Symbol("p") q = sy.Symbol("q") c = 1 n = 1 nc = 1Īnd here's some timings comparing your original iterative dot approach to matrix_power: %%timeit Matrix calculator that shows work This solver performs operations with matrices i.e. Here's the setup code I used: import numpy as np If we have two functions, we can also organize. Matrix Equations Calculator - Symbolab Matrix Equations Calculator Solve matrix equations step-by-step full pad Examples Related Symbolab blog posts High School Math Solutions Quadratic Equations Calculator, Part 1 A quadratic equation is a second degree polynomial having the general form ax2 bx c 0, where a, b, and c. For your special use case, I'd recommend using _power (which wasn't mentioned in the linked question). Gradient vectors organize all of the partial derivatives for a specific scalar function.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|